软考
APP下载

ifconfig设置DHCP

在计算机网络中,DHCP(动态主机配置协议)是一种用于自动分配IP地址的协议。通过使用DHCP,计算机可以在未配置IP地址的情况下访问网络。ifconfig是一种网络接口配置实用程序,它用于配置TCP/IP网络接口参数。本文将从多个角度分析ifconfig如何设置DHCP。

ifconfig是Linux和其他Unix类操作系统上的命令行接口实用程序。该实用程序用于配置网络接口参数,例如设置IP地址、子网掩码和默认网关。ifconfig命令也可用于启用或禁用网络接口。要在Linux中使用ifconfig设置DHCP,请按以下步骤操作:

1. 打开终端,并用root用户或sudo权限运行终端,以便访问ifconfig。

2. 输入ifconfig命令,以查看系统中当前可用的网络接口。

3. 找到要配置DHCP的接口,例如eth0。

4. 输入sudo ifconfig eth0 dhcp启用DHCP,以使用DHCP自动分配IP地址。

5. 输入sudo ifconfig eth0 down && sudo ifconfig eth0 up重启网络接口,以应用新的DHCP设置。

ifconfig自动设置DHCP需要注意以下几点:

1. 如果计算机连接到的网络不支持DHCP,则计算机将无法获得IP地址和其他必要的网络配置信息。在这种情况下,可以手动分配IP地址。

2. 如果网络中存在多个DHCP服务器,则可能会发生IP地址冲突。为了避免这种情况,可以在DHCP服务器上配置静态IP地址分配或使用其他网络配置方案。

3. 如果计算机上的网络接口无法正确识别DHCP请求,则DHCP请求将无法处理。在这种情况下,可以升级计算机上的网卡驱动程序或使用其他网络配置方案。

在计算机网络中,ifconfig和DHCP都具有重要的作用。ifconfig用于配置网络接口参数,而DHCP用于自动分配IP地址和其他必要的网络配置信息。通过使用ifconfig设置DHCP,计算机可以自动配置其网络接口,从而实现快速的自动化网络连接。但是,在使用ifconfig设置DHCP之前,应该注意网络配置是否支持DHCP,以及网络中是否存在其他DHCP服务器或其他网络配置方案。

备考资料 免费领取:网络工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
网络工程师题库